Intervention Case 2

CUES Partner

TCA & FINT

Location

  • Italy

Target Group

Large manufacturing, research institutes, cooperatives, consumers

Challenge

Communicating transparent and credible information by large manufacturing/food producers to gain consumers’ trust.

Intervention

Integrating technological innovations like QR-code to increase food traceability and transparency in the value chain of multiple food manufacturers (TCA is a consortium of 31 food manufacturing companies). Equipping end-consumers with detailed information about the products will allow them to make informed decisions about sustainable consumption, ultimately leading to sustainable value chain transformation. Organisational innovation interventions include not-for-profit activities and social enterprising (for-profit).

Expected Outcome

Increase in sustainable food consumption.

Expected Impact

Environmental: Reduction in energy consumption of packaging part of the supply chain, GHG emissions reduction through increasing sustainable packaging.

Social: Food safety and security, reducing poverty, increasing societal equality and equity.

Economic: Efficient use of material, energy-efficient production, dematerialization of products and packaging, multi-functionality of materials.
